As I understand it franchised garages have an agreement with the manufacturer that they will buy a certain number (or value) of cars every month.
They *have* to buy them whether they have customers for them or not. Even if it means buying them and selling them on at a loss.
This is why you see so many 'pre-registered' deals around.0 -

...How much is a brand new Corsa? How much is a brand new Polo?
Here are the figures. Note these are the cheapest models available and are based on OTR list prices as published on the manufacturer's UK websites:
Vauxhall Corsa 1.2 £10.680 (£10,255 for smaller 1.0)
Ford Fiesta £10,895
Volkswagon Polo £9,435
I think if you feature adjust the price, you'll find them all very competitive with one another.
Of course it's then up to what you can negotiate with your dealer. Naturally the heavier the demand, the lower the discount probably achievable."Now to trolling as a concept. ....
